Tiehdang Population - West Khasi Hills, Meghalaya

Tiehdang is a medium size village located in Mawthadraishan Block of West Khasi Hills district, Meghalaya with total 40 families residing. The Tiehdang village has population of 211 of which 106 are males while 105 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Tiehdang village population of children with age 0-6 is 50 which makes up 23.70 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Tiehdang village is 991 which is higher than Meghalaya state average of 989. Child Sex Ratio for the Tiehdang as per census is 1000, higher than Meghalaya average of 970.

Tiehdang village has higher literacy rate compared to Meghalaya. In 2011, literacy rate of Tiehdang village was 85.71 % compared to 74.43 % of Meghalaya. In Tiehdang Male literacy stands at 86.42 % while female literacy rate was 85.00 %.

Caste Factor

In Tiehdang village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 99.05 % of total population in Tiehdang village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Tiehdang village of West Khasi Hills.

Work Profile

In Tiehdang village out of total population, 97 were engaged in work activities. 5.15 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 94.85 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months.
